Career path

Career Role (Primary Keyword: Quantitative Analyst) Description
Senior Quantitative Analyst (Secondary Keyword: Financial Modeling) Develop sophisticated financial models, utilizing advanced statistical techniques and programming skills for risk management and investment strategies. High demand within UK investment banks.
Data Scientist (Secondary Keyword: Machine Learning) Extract insights from large datasets using machine learning algorithms and statistical analysis. Crucial role across various sectors, including finance, tech, and healthcare. Strong UK job market.
Actuary (Secondary Keyword: Risk Assessment) Assess and manage financial risks using statistical modeling and probabilistic methods. A highly specialized role with strong career prospects in insurance and pensions.
Quantitative Researcher (Secondary Keyword: Algorithmic Trading) Design and implement advanced algorithms for trading strategies. High earning potential and a competitive job market within the UK's financial technology sector.
